stationieren

to station

To place military units or equipment at a specific location for a certain period of time.

example

Die NATO hat zusätzliche Truppen an der Ostflanke stationiert.

NATO has stationed additional troops on the eastern flank.

stationieren vs einsetzen

to insert / to begin / to use

'einsetzen' and 'stationieren' can both mean that people or things are brought to a specific place or used for a task. 'einsetzen' is more general: you can use personnel, money, technology, or time for a purpose. The location is not always important. 'stationieren' fits better when people, equipment, or especially military units are meant to remain at a fixed location for a certain period of time. Learners may confuse the words when talking about emergency personnel or technology. A simple guide is: 'einsetzen' emphasizes the task, while 'stationieren' emphasizes the location and the longer-term position there.

stationieren

Zur Sicherheit wurden vor dem Stadion mehrere Rettungswagen stationiert.

For safety, several ambulances were stationed in front of the stadium.

einsetzen

Die Stadt setzt zusätzliche Busse ein, weil heute viele Besucher kommen.

The city is using additional buses because many visitors are coming today.
